Valuation read
LLY trades at 38.61× trailing earnings.
A trailing P/E above 30 means the market is paying up for LLY. That premium has to be earned with above-average revenue or earnings growth.

Margin profile
Profitability read
LLY converts 33.5% of revenue into net income.
Net margins above 20% are the hallmark of pricing-power businesses — software, brands, and franchises. Watch for trend, not just level: a falling margin in this band still erodes the multiple.
